The cheapest way to get from London to World of Country Life is to bus which costs £24 - £90 and takes 6h 43m.
The fastest way to get from London to World of Country Life is to drive which takes 3h 19m and costs £40 - £60.
No, there is no direct bus from London to World of Country Life. However, there are services departing from London Victoria and arriving at World of Country Life via Bus Station and Savoy Cinema.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 43m.
No, there is no direct train from London to World of Country Life. However, there are services departing from London Paddington and arriving at Exmouth via Exeter St Davids.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 51m.
The distance between London and World of Country Life is 188 miles. The road distance is 172.7 miles.
The best way to get from London to World of Country Life without a car is to train which takes 3h 51m and costs £85 - £160.
It takes approximately 3h 51m to get from London to World of Country Life, including transfers.
London to World of Country Life bus services, operated by National Express, depart from London Victoria station.
London to World of Country Life train services, operated by Great Western Railway (GWR), depart from London Paddington station.
The best way to get from London to World of Country Life is to train which takes 3h 51m and costs £85 - £160.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£24 - £90 and takes 6h 43m, you could also fly, which costs £160 - £400 and takes 5h 58m.
What companies run services between London, England and World of Country Life, England?
Great Western Railway (GWR) operates a train from London Paddington to Exeter St Davids hourly. Tickets cost £75–150 and the journey takes 2h 10m.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from London Victoria to Bampfylde Street every 3 hours. Tickets cost £30–80 and the journey takes 5h. FlixBus also services this route 4 times a day.
